Financial Analyst Salary in Athens, Georgia

The median financial analyst salary in Athens, GA is $87,474 per year, which is 8% below the national median and 3.2% below the Georgia state average.

Financial Analyst Salary in Athens by Experience

In Athens, an entry-level financial analyst earns around $55,200, while experienced professionals earn up to $136,160 per year. The local cost of living index is 90% of the national average.

Job Outlook

Nationally, financial analyst employment is projected to grow 8% over the next decade (faster than average). Demand in Athens may vary based on local industry and population growth.
